
PLANTS SHOW 網(wǎng)站建設
還原刪除的何還原表數據是MySQL數據庫管理中常見(jiàn)的需求之一,下面是刪除數(′▽?zhuān)?據詳細的步驟和相關(guān)解答??:
在還原刪除的表數據之前,首先需要確保有備份的記錄數據可供恢復,可以使用以下方法進(jìn)行(xing)備份:
1、何還原導出數據庫:使用mysqldump命令將整個(gè)數據庫導出為SQL文件。刪除數據
“`
mysqldump u 用戶(hù)名 p 密碼 數據庫名 > 備份文件名.sql
“`
2、記??錄導出特定表:如果只需要備份特定的何還原表,可以使用mysqldu??mp命令并指定表(biao)名。刪除數據
??8220;`
mysqldump u 用戶(hù)名 p 密碼 數據庫名 表名 >(T_T); 備份文件名.sqヾ(?■_■)ノl
(O_O)220;`
1、何還原創(chuàng )建新表:如果被刪除的刪除數據(ju)表已經(jīng)不存在,需要先創(chuàng )建(jian)一個(gè)與原表結構相同的記錄新表,可以使用CREATE TABLE語(yǔ)句來(lái)定義表的結構。
“`sql
CREATE TABLE 表名 (
列名1 數據類(lèi)型,
R??30;
“`
2、導入備份數據:使用mysql命令將備份的SQL文件導入到數據庫中。
“`
mysql u 用戶(hù)名 p 密碼 數據庫名 < 備份文件名.sql
(′?`)220;`
“`sql
SELECT * FROM 表名;
“`
問(wèn)題1:如果備份數據時(shí)沒(méi)有指定表名,如何只恢復特定的表?
解答:如果備份數據時(shí)沒(méi)有指定表名,可以使用mysqldump命令的??tables選項來(lái)指定要備份的表。
mysqldump u 用戶(hù)名 p 密碼 tables 表名1,表名2,... > 備份文件名.sql
然后按照上述步驟恢復數據即可。
問(wèn)題2:如果備份數據時(shí)使用的是不同版本的MySQL數據庫,是否可以兼容恢復?
解答:MySQL的備份和恢復操作在不同的版本之間可能存在兼容性問(wèn)題,建議使用相同版本的MySQL來(lái)進(jìn)行備份和恢復操作,以確保數據的??完整性和兼容性,如果必須使用ヽ(′ー`)ノ不同版本的MySQ(′?ω?`)L,可以嘗試升級或降級數(′?`*)據庫版本,或者使用其他工具和方法來(lái)實(shí)現數據的遷移和恢復。